A leading consultancy is looking for a Rights of Light Surveyor to join its growing London team. The role involves delivering Rights of Light and Daylight/Sunlight advice, working closely with developers, and preparing technical reports on significant projects. Candidates should have over 3 years of consultancy experience, particularly in Rights of Light. The position offers competitive salary and clear progression opportunities, with the chance to work on prominent developments across the UK.
